Calculating Odds in Casino Games

Calculating odds in casino games involves understanding the relationship between the number of possible outcomes and the likelihood of each outcome occurring. For example, in a game of roulette, there are 37 numbers on the wheel (in European roulette), so the odds of landing on a specific number would be 1 in 37. In blackjack, the odds of being dealt a blackjack (an Ace and a 10-value card) are approximately 4.8%. Understanding these odds can help players make strategic decisions and minimize the house edge.

Understanding Probability in Casino Games

Probability in casino games refers to the likelihood of a specific event occurring, such as drawing a certain card from a deck or hitting a specific number on the roulette wheel. Understanding probability involves knowing the total number of possible outcomes and the number of favorable outcomes. For instance, in a game of poker, calculating the probability of drawing a flush involves knowing the number of cards in the deck and the number of cards that can make a flush. By understanding probability, players can gauge the risk and potential reward of their decisions.

The Role of Randomness in Casino Games

While understanding odds and probability is crucial, it’s important to remember that casino games are ultimately based on randomness. The outcomes of casino games are determined by random events, such as a dice roll or a card draw, and no amount of skill or strategy can guarantee a win. Understanding the role of randomness can help players approach casino games with a realistic mindset and avoid falling into the trap of superstitions or misconceptions about “lucky” or “unlucky” outcomes.
